Description

Appartamento in vendita a San Tammaro, zona Nazionale. Proponiamo in vendita in esclusiva a San Tammaro, in zona In zona tranquilla, di facile raggiungimento, ben collegata sia con Capua che con il centro cittadino .... in parco formato da minicondomini di 6 unità cadauno anno 2009. La casa si presenta di già in buono stato, internamente è di c.ca 100mq e si suddivide in: ingresso in salone, cucina, tre camere da letto, doppio servizio ( uno con vasca e l altro con doccia ) e ripostiglio. Completa la soluzione comodo box auto di c,ca 16 mq, posto auto condominiale e due ampie balconate di c.ca 10mq cada una. N.B : L'appartamento è attualmente locato a 400 € mensili , libero da Maggio 2026! Visa

Digital Nomad Visa — requires remote work for foreign clients/employers, min €28,000/yr net income, and 6 months work experience. Valid 1 year, renewable. Elective Residence Visa — for retirees and those with passive income (€31,000/yr minimum, no work allowed). Both offer a path to long-term residency.

Key Fact

Italy launched its digital nomad visa in 2024, making it much easier for remote workers than the old elective residence route. Italian bureaucracy is notoriously slow (3-6 months processing), so patience and a good immigration lawyer are essential.

Cost of buying in Italy

Estimated fees and ongoing costs for this property

Closing Costs

7-12% of purchase price

  • ·Registration tax: 2% (primary) or 9% (second home)
  • ·Notary: €2,000-5,000
  • ·Cadastral tax: €50
  • ·Agent: 3-4% + VAT

Annual Costs

Property Tax

0.4-0.76% of cadastral value (IMU — not on primary residence)

Insurance

€200-500/yr

HOA / Condo Fees

€50-200/mo for apartments (spese condominiali)

Good to Know

Agent Fees

Buyer pays own agent (3-4% + 22% VAT)

Foreign Buyer Note

Reciprocity requirement — Americans can buy freely (US-Italy treaty). Codice fiscale (tax ID) required. 9% registration tax on second homes is significant.
